您好,欢迎来到微智科技网。
搜索
您的当前位置:首页数据流程图与其他流程图(如业务流程图、程序流程图等)有何区别和联系?

数据流程图与其他流程图(如业务流程图、程序流程图等)有何区别和联系?

来源:微智科技网


数据流程图是一种用于展示数据在系统中流动和处理过程的图表,主要用于描述数据在系统中的传递和转换关系。数据流程图通常包括数据流、处理过程、数据存储和数据源/目的地等基本元素。数据流程图的主要目的是帮助人们理解系统中数据的流动路径,揭示数据处理的逻辑关系,帮助设计和优化数据处理流程。

与数据流程图相比,业务流程图更侧重于描述业务过程中各个环节的流程和关系,包括业务活动、决策点、文档和参与者等元素,用于展示业务流程的逻辑和操作步骤。业务流程图通常用于分析和改进业务流程,优化组织运作。

程序流程图则是描述程序或算法执行过程的图表,包括顺序结构、选择结构、循环结构等,用于展示程序的逻辑流程和执行步骤。程序流程图通常用于编程和软件开发过程中,帮助程序员理解程序逻辑和设计算法。

联系方面,数据流程图、业务流程图和程序流程图都是用于描述系统或过程中的逻辑关系和流程,从不同角度展示了不同类型的流程和处理过程。在实际应用中,这三种图表可能会相互关联,例如业务流程图中的某个业务活动可能对应数据流程图中的数据流转换过程,程序流程图则是对业务流程或数据流程的具体实现。

在实际应用中,可以将这三种图表结合起来,通过数据流程图分析和设计数据流转过程,再结合业务流程图优化业务流程,最后编写程序流程图实现具体的算法和逻辑。这样的综合方法可以帮助管理者更全面地理解系统的运作逻辑,提高系统的效率和质量。

举例来说,假设一个公司要优化订单处理流程,可以先绘制业务流程图分析订单处理的各个环节和参与者,再绘制数据流程图展示订单信息在系统中的流动路径和处理过程,最后编写程序流程图实现订单处理的具体逻辑和算法,从而全面优化订单处理流程,提高公司的效率和服务质量。

Copyright © 2019- 7swz.com 版权所有 赣ICP备2024042798号-8

违法及侵权请联系:TEL:199 18 7713 E-MAIL:2724546146@qq.com

本站由北京市万商天勤律师事务所王兴未律师提供法律服务